Anant Motors is located in Neemuch, India on Mhow - Neemuch Rd, Schme No 34, Vikas Nagar. Anant Motors is rated 4.5 out of 5 in the category towing service in India.
Address
Mhow - Neemuch Rd, Schme No 34, Vikas Nagar
Amenities
Gender-neutral toilets
Accessibility
Wheelchair-accessible seating
Wheelchair-accessible toilet